Instructions for Use:

  1. Power Supply Connection:

    • Connect the VDD pin to the power supply.
    • Ensure the supply voltage is within the specified range (2.7V to 5.5V).
  2. Ground Connection:

    • Connect the GND pin to the system ground.
  3. Output Connection:

    • Connect the VOUT pin to the load or circuit that requires regulated power.
  4. Capacitors:

    • Place a 10渭F ceramic capacitor between VDD and GND as close as possible to the device to ensure stability.
    • Place a 10渭F ceramic capacitor between VOUT and GND to filter noise and stabilize the output.
  5. Thermal Management:

    • Ensure adequate heat dissipation if operating at high currents or temperatures.
    • The device can operate up to 85掳C ambient temperature, but thermal resistance should be considered for higher loads.
  6. Standby Mode:

    • To enter standby mode, set the enable pin (if available) to a low state.
    • Standby current is typically around 1渭A.
  7. Operating Temperature:

    • The device is rated for operation from -40掳C to 85掳C.
    • For storage, the temperature range is -65掳C to 150掳C.
  8. Handling Precautions:

    • Handle the device with care to avoid static damage.
    • Follow proper soldering techniques to prevent thermal shock and mechanical stress.
